The Experience
You board in Alcudia's Bay and the catamaran sets course north toward the island's most dramatic coastline. The boat carries all the amenities for a half-day at sea—shade, seating, the crew managing the sail while a professional guide points out the landmarks and the geology as you move through the water. The route passes Puerto Pollensa before reaching Formentor Beach, one of the world's most photographed stretches of sand, where the catamaran anchors and you get time to swim, snorkel or simply float in the shallows.
The tour runs 4.5 hours total, which means you leave Alcudia in the morning or early afternoon and return with most of the day still ahead. Bring a swimsuit, sunscreen and a camera; the boat is suitable for all fitness levels, and children from age 3 can come along (infants sit on an adult's lap, and older kids travel comfortably). The guide speaks English and Spanish, so the commentary works regardless of which language you prefer.

Can I swim at Formentor Beach during the tour?
Yes—the catamaran anchors at Formentor Beach and you have time to swim, snorkel and wade in the water before the return journey to Alcudia.
What's the difference between Formentor and Puerto Pollensa on this route?
Puerto Pollensa is a coastal town the catamaran passes on the way north; Formentor Beach is the final destination where you stop and spend time in the water. Both offer views, but only Formentor is where you anchor and swim.
Is this tour suitable for young children?
Children from age 3 are welcome; infants must sit on an adult's lap. The boat is stable and suitable for all fitness levels, and the 4.5-hour duration works for most families, though you'll want to bring sun protection and keep them hydrated.
What happens if the weather turns bad?
The catamaran has amenities and shade on board. The tour operates in typical sea conditions; if conditions become unsafe, the operator will advise you before departure or adjust the route.
Do I need to arrange my own transport to Alcudia Bay?
Yes—transport to the departure point is not included, though public transportation options are available nearby. Plan your arrival at the dock with time to spare before the tour begins.
What should I bring on the catamaran?
Bring a swimsuit, sunscreen, sunglasses, comfortable clothing and a camera. The boat provides the catamaran, crew and insurance; food and drinks are not included, so bring water and snacks if you prefer.
